Trade and Industry Minister Tan See Leng says Singapore risks losing good talent if the financial cost of entering politics becomes too high. He said the challenge is reducing the opportunity cost for Singaporeans to step forward and join the government earlier, while they are still in the prime of their careers. A former medical doctor, Dr Tan gave up a nearly 30-year career to enter politics in 2020. He shared that he would never have entered politics if money was his primary consideration. He also stressed that the review of political salaries is not about matching ministers' salary to private sector pay. Ivy Chok reports.
